干瘪
/ gānbiě /
Strokes
Definition
dried out/wizened/shriveled
Example
As an Adjective
dry; dried-up; wizened; shrivelled
1
Shìzi
柿子
dōu
都
gěi
给
tàiyang
太阳
shài
晒
gānbiě
干瘪
le
了
。
The persimmons have all dried up/out in the sun. / The persimmons have all shrivelled up in the sun.
2
Gānbiě
干瘪
de
的
xiǎo
小
lǎotóu
老头
dried-up/wizened little old man
As an Adjective
(of speech or writing) dry; dull; arid
3
Nā
那
shì
是
wǒ
我
suǒ
所
kàn
看
guò
过
de
的
zuì
最
gānbiě
干瘪
de
的
wénzhāng
文章
。
It's the driest article I've ever read.
